General annotation (Comments)
| Function | Stabilizes the aggregates of proteoglycan monomers with hyaluronic acid in the extracellular cartilage matrix. |
| Subcellular location | |
| Tissue specificity | Widely expressed. Weakly expressed in the brain. Ref.8 Ref.9 |
| Sequence similarities | Belongs to the HAPLN family. Contains 1 Ig-like V-type (immunoglobulin-like) domain. Contains 2 Link domains. |
